Situation
This property is conveniently situated between the towns of Ascot and Windsor, with their mixture of day to day shopping facilities and comprehensive range of cultural activities, which includes Ascot racecourse, Windsor Castle, the Long Walk, Eton and the River Thames. The area is well known for its outstanding schools, with both Cranbourne and Charters schools lying within this property's catchment, as well as numerous pre-school nurseries and play groups. Both Ascot and Windsor have excellent road communications with access to the M4 from junction 6 leading to the M25 and the M3. It enjoys direct rail access to London's Waterloo station from Windsor and Eton Riverside Station and to Paddington Station via Slough from Windsor Central Station.
